UFC Fighters are some of the strongest, most athletic and highly tuned athletes in the world. You already know that they work out and train very hard, but what exactly do they eat?
Andrei Arlovski: “I take Gamma O 2x a day and I try to only eat chicken, fish, fruits and vegetables.”
Randy Couture: “The green drink has been a phenomenal addition to my diet and training plan.”
Sean Salmon: “You know, I wasn?t getting as many calories as I needed, which in turn was affecting my training. This time around, I started training real hard, you know, two a day and three a day workouts at twelve weeks out but I didn?t do a thing with my diet until four weeks out and that kind of enabled me to give me those extra calories, extra sugar, extra fat to really keep my training intensity real high and my motivation real high. So, I think this has been my best, most productive training camp ever and I think that?s one of the reasons why.”
Elvis Sinosic: “No specific diet. I try and stay away from carbohydrates after 6pm. I try to eat smaller meals (to keep my metabolism up). I tend to eat lots of chicken, rice, and pastas in the lead up to a fight.”
Mac Danzig: “It wasn?t until I was 20 and I got a job working at an animal sanctuary in Pennsylvania called Ooh-Mah-Nee Farm that I was able to meet people who were vegan and realize how strongly some people felt about it and how many healthy alternatives to animal products there were. I experimented with a vegan diet for about a year, but once I started training full-time for fighting, I believed what certain people said and started eating chicken again because I thought that I had to have some kind of animal protein in order to be a successful athlete. It was crazy because my diet was still pretty much vegan, except for chicken about three times a week. It never sat right with me. ? I would still go through spells where I just couldn?t eat it, and about 2 years ago, I read a Mike Mahler article on an animal rights Web site where he explained his vegan diet for training in detail, and I said, ?That?s it?I can do it too,? and I started 100 percent vegan again for life and I?ve never looked back. I feel great.”
